上一页 1 ··· 4 5 6 7 8
摘要: 1:用.Net做一个小型的本地播放器。 播放器所播放的所有歌曲都是由本地磁盘读取得到的,只需要用using System.IO;命名空间下面的DirectoryInfo的GetFiles();就能把文件读取出来,加个判断把MP3文件读取出来把MP3文件中的信息保存在泛型中即可。这一系列的操作如下图:读取保存的操作也就这样就结束了,接下去就是播放了。播放最简单了,把泛型里面的数据显示出来到DataGridView中或者ListView中就行了。到时候写个单击事件把歌曲的Url给播放器,播放器就能够播放了。一首歌曲播放完的时候就把下一首歌曲的Url拿出来给播放器让播放器播放下一首歌曲。具体的操作. 阅读全文
posted @ 2013-02-23 12:09 Bright Moon ‘ s Blog 阅读(700) 评论(0) 推荐(0) 编辑
摘要: 1:关于实例化对象 我先创建一个FullChannel对象,FullChannel fullchannel = new FullChannel();这个时候堆栈内存的示意图如下在栈内存里面有块区域划出来给FullCannel用,在堆内存里面也划出了一块区域用来存储FullCannel里面的数据,并且把堆内存的引用给了栈内存的FullCannel。现在我再创建一个对象MyFavor myFavor = fullcannel;这个时候堆栈内存的示意图如下执行MyFavor myFavor = fullcannel;的时候也就是把fullcannel在堆内存中的引用给了myFaovr。也就是说两个对 阅读全文
posted @ 2013-02-23 12:08 Bright Moon ‘ s Blog 阅读(975) 评论(0) 推荐(0) 编辑
摘要: 1:在C#语言中,重载和重写的区别(1)重写:重写是子类的方法覆盖父类的方法,要求方法名和参数都相同 (2)重载:重载是在同一个类中的两个或两个以上的方法,拥有相同的方法名,但是参数却不相同,方法体也不相同,最常见的重载的例子就是类的构造函数,可以参考API帮助文档看看类的构造方法 阅读全文
posted @ 2013-02-23 12:06 Bright Moon ‘ s Blog 阅读(179) 评论(0) 推荐(0) 编辑
摘要: 1. Get a Head StartLeave home 30 minutes earlier than normal. Studies find that the less rushed you feel in the morning, the less stressed you'll be for the rest of the day.2. Bring SnacksBring a spill-proof coffee cup filled with your favorite brew to the office, and have a bag of nonperishable 阅读全文
posted @ 2013-02-23 12:02 Bright Moon ‘ s Blog 阅读(333) 评论(0) 推荐(0) 编辑
摘要: 1、泛型集合绑定数据源到DataGridView: 在DataGridView中需要显示需要的数据的话可以在代码中绑定数据源来实现,要注意的是绑定泛型集合到DataGridView数据源中和DataSet绑定有一点不相同。使用DataSet作为DataGridView的数据源的时候只需要直接给DataGridView的DataSource属性赋值即可。如果需要刷新数据的话只要再给DataGridView的DataSource属性赋值即可。而使用泛型集合作为DataGridView的数据源的时候刷新则不能和使用DataSet作为数据源刷新的操作一样,根据本人的经验有两种方法可以实现:一种是使用. 阅读全文
posted @ 2013-02-23 11:45 Bright Moon ‘ s Blog 阅读(558) 评论(0) 推荐(0) 编辑
上一页 1 ··· 4 5 6 7 8